Specifications

Manufacturer
John Deere
Model
3310
Category
Utility
Manufacturing Years
1998 - 2002
Manufacturer
John Deere
Model
John Deere
Power Output
75hp
Rated RPM
2,050RPM
Cylinders
4
Displacement
276ci
Bore
4.19in
Stroke
5in

Type
Synchronized / Power shift
Length
159.8in
Height
100in
Operating Weight
7,550lb

Type
Optional Transmission or Live PTO
Speed 1
540rpm
Hitch Type
Three-point
Hitch Category
II
Hitch Position
Rear
Chassis Type
4x4 MFWD 4WD
Drive Type
MFWD 4WD
Steering Type
Hydrostatic power
Brake Type
Wet disc
Type
Cab
